在数字化世界中,网络安全已经成为了一个重要的议题,在这个背景下,HTTPS安全超文本传输协议(Hypertext Transfer Protocol Secure)应运而生,它是一种用于保护网络通信的安全协议,本文将深入探讨HTTPS的工作原理,以及它如何提供安全保障。
HTTPS是HTTP的安全版本,它在HTTP的基础上加入了SSL/TLS加密层,以保护数据在网络中的传输过程,HTTP是一种无状态的、明文的协议,这意味着在数据传输过程中,任何第三方都可以轻易地截获和查看数据,而HTTPS则通过SSL/TLS协议,对数据进行加密处理,使得数据在传输过程中变得难以被破解和篡改。
SSL/TLS协议是一种公钥基础设施(Public Key Infrastructure,PKI)的一部分,它使用非对称加密和对称加密两种技术来保护数据的安全,在HTTPS的握手过程中,客户端会向服务器发送一个“ClientHello”消息,这个消息包含了客户端支持的SSL/TLS版本、加密算法等信息,服务器收到这个消息后,会选择一个合适的SSL/TLS版本和加密算法,然后向客户端发送一个“ServerHello”消息。
在“ServerHello”消息中,服务器会包含自己的证书信息,这个证书是由可信的证书颁发机构(Certificate Authority,CA)颁发的,客户端收到服务器的证书后,会检查证书的有效性,包括证书的有效期、证书的颁发者等信息,如果证书有效,客户端会生成一个随机的对称密钥,然后用服务器的公钥对这个密钥进行加密,然后将加密后的密钥发送给服务器。
服务器收到加密后的密钥后,用自己的私钥进行解密,得到原始的对称密钥,服务器和客户端就可以使用这个对称密钥来加密和解密数据了,在这个过程中,所有的数据都会被加密,包括HTTP头部、URL、POST数据等,这使得数据在传输过程中变得难以被破解和篡改。
除了加密,HTTPS还提供了一种机制,用于验证服务器的身份,这就是前面提到的证书,证书是由CA颁发的,它包含了服务器的公钥和一些其他的信息,如服务器的名字、证书的有效期等,客户端在收到服务器的证书后,会检查证书的有效性,如果证书有效,那么客户端就可以确认服务器的身份。
HTTPS通过SSL/TLS协议,对数据进行加密处理,并提供了证书验证机制,以保护数据在网络中的传输过程,这使得HTTPS成为了一种非常安全的协议,它被广泛应用于各种网络应用中,如网上银行、电子商务、社交网络等。
尽管HTTPS提供了强大的安全保障,但是它并不是绝对安全的,SSL/TLS协议本身存在一些已知的安全漏洞,这些漏洞可能被攻击者利用,虽然证书可以验证服务器的身份,但是如果CA的私钥被泄露,那么攻击者就可以伪造证书,从而伪装成合法的服务器,HTTPS的握手过程可能会受到中间人攻击,攻击者可以在客户端和服务器之间插入自己,截获和篡改数据。
为了应对这些安全问题,我们需要不断地更新和改进HTTPS协议,修复已知的安全漏洞,提高证书的安全性,以及开发新的安全技术,我们也需要提高用户的安全意识,让用户了解HTTPS的重要性,以及如何使用HTTPS来保护自己的数据安全。
HTTPS安全超文本传输协议是一种非常重要的网络安全技术,它为网络通信提供了强大的安全保障,网络安全是一个永恒的话题,我们需要不断地学习和探索,以提高我们的网络安全水平。
HTTPS的应用广泛,从简单的网页浏览到复杂的电子商务交易,都可以看到它的身影,HTTPS的使用并不总是那么简单,一些网站可能会阻止用户访问HTTPS站点,或者只提供HTTPS服务,这可能会导致一些问题,HTTPS的性能开销也比HTTP大,这可能会影响网站的加载速度。
尽管存在这些问题,但是HTTPS的优点仍然超过了它的缺点,随着网络安全问题的日益严重,我们有理由相信,HTTPS将会越来越重要,它将会成为我们网络生活的重要组成部分。
在未来,我们期待看到更多的技术创新,以进一步提高HTTPS的安全性和效率,我们也期待看到更多的用户和组织使用HTTPS,以保护他们的数据安全。
HTTPS安全超文本传输协议是一种非常重要的网络安全技术,它为网络通信提供了强大的安全保障,网络安全是一个永恒的话题,我们需要不断地学习和探索,以提高我们的网络安全水平。
HTTPS的应用广泛,从简单的网页浏览到复杂的电子商务交易,都可以看到它的身影,HTTPS的使用并不总是那么简单,一些网站可能会阻止用户访问HTTPS站点,或者只提供HTTPS服务,这可能会导致一些问题,HTTPS的性能开销也比HTTP大,这可能会影响网站的加载速度。
尽管存在这些问题,但是HTTPS的优点仍然超过了它的缺点,随着网络安全问题的日益严重,我们有理由相信,HTTPS将会越来越重要,它将会成为我们网络生活的重要组成部分。
在未来,我们期待看到更多的技术创新,以进一步提高HTTPS的安全性和效率,我们也期待看到更多的用户和组织使用HTTPS,以保护他们的数据安全。